Что такое последовательные порты

Последовательные порты являются одним из самых старых и распространенных интерфейсов в компьютерной технике. Они используются для передачи данных между компьютером и внешними устройствами, такими как принтеры, модемы, сканеры и другое оборудование.

Одним из основных преимуществ использования последовательных портов является их простота и универсальность. Они могут быть использованы со множеством устройств и работать на различных скоростях передачи данных. Кроме того, последовательные порты обеспечивают надежную передачу данных даже на большие расстояния.

Работа последовательных портов основана на принципе передачи данных побитово. Данные передаются последовательно, один бит за другим. Каждому биту соответствует определенное электрическое состояние — высокий или низкий уровень напряжения. При передаче данных определенная последовательность битов образует байт, который представляет собой информацию, доступную для обработки компьютером или устройством.

Преимущества последовательных портов сохраняют их актуальность даже с появлением новых интерфейсов, таких как USB и Ethernet. В некоторых случаях, включая отладку и настройку устройств, использование последовательных портов остается единственным доступным способом передачи данных.

В заключение можно сказать, что последовательные порты являются важной частью современных компьютерных систем. Они позволяют обмениваться данными с различными внешними устройствами, обеспечивая надежность передачи и простоту использования.

Последовательные порты: основные принципы работы

Основные принципы работы последовательных портов следующие:

ПринципОписание
Физическое подключениеПоследовательные порты физически подключаются к компьютеру с помощью последовательного кабеля или адаптера.
СигналыПоследовательные порты передают данные в виде последовательности сигналов, состоящих из битов информации.
Битовая скоростьПоследовательные порты имеют определенную битовую скорость, которая определяет количество битов данных, передаваемых в секунду.
Контроль потокаПоследовательные порты могут использовать различные методы контроля потока, чтобы предотвратить потерю данных во время передачи.
ПротоколыПоследовательные порты часто используют специальные протоколы для обмена данными между компьютером и подключенным устройством.

Использование последовательных портов широко распространено в различных областях, таких как промышленность, автоматизация, телекоммуникации и т. д. Они обеспечивают надежное соединение и передачу данных между компьютерами и устройствами.

Что такое последовательные порты?

В отличие от параллельного порта, который использует несколько проводов для передачи данных одновременно, последовательный порт использует только один провод для передачи данных по одному биту за раз. Этот провод называется серийной линией данных (TX или TXD).

Помимо серийной линии данных, последовательный порт также включает другие провода, такие как линия приема данных (RX или RXD), линия управления потоком (например, RTS и CTS) и линии заземления (GND).

Последовательные порты обычно используются для подключения устройств с низкой скоростью передачи данных, таких как модемы, принтеры, сканеры штрих-кода, GPS-приемники и т. д. Однако, с появлением новых интерфейсов, таких как USB и Bluetooth, использование последовательных портов существенно сократилось.

Принцип работы последовательных портов

Основной принцип работы последовательных портов состоит в том, что информация передается по одному биту за раз. Данные отправляются по одному биту последовательно, один за другим. Это отличается от параллельных портов, где данные передаются одновременно по нескольким битам.

Передача данных по последовательным портам осуществляется с помощью соответствующих протоколов, таких как RS-232, RS-485, USB и других. Эти протоколы определяют формат передаваемых данных, скорость передачи, контроль потока и другие параметры связи.

Для связи с устройством, подключенным к последовательному порту, необходимо правильно настроить соответствующие параметры. Это может быть сделано с помощью специального программного обеспечения или командной строки. Настройки включают в себя скорость передачи данных (бод), биты данных, биты контроля четности, стоп-биты и другие.

При передаче данных по последовательному порту отправитель посылает биты данных, а приемник принимает их и обрабатывает. При этом обе стороны должны быть синхронизированы и настроены на одинаковые параметры связи.

Использование последовательных портов имеет свои преимущества и недостатки. Они обеспечивают надежное соединение и могут передавать данные на большие расстояния. Однако, скорость передачи данных по последовательным портам меньше, чем по параллельным портам, и они могут быть восприимчивы к помехам и шумам.

Тем не менее, последовательные порты до сих пор широко используются во многих областях, таких как промышленность, автоматизация, медицина и другие, где требуется устойчивая и надежная связь с внешними устройствами.

Различные типы последовательных портов

Существует несколько различных типов последовательных портов, которые могут быть использованы для передачи данных:

  • RS-232: Это самый распространенный тип последовательного порта и часто используется для подключения периферийных устройств, таких как модемы, принтеры и сканеры. RS-232 порты могут передавать и принимать данные по одному биту за раз и работать на разных скоростях передачи данных.
  • RS-485: Этот тип последовательного порта используется для подключения нескольких устройств к одному порту. RS-485 порты могут передавать данные в оба направления, а также поддерживать дальнейшую передачу сигнала на расстоянии до 1200 метров.
  • USB: USB порты являются одним из самых популярных способов подключения периферийных устройств к компьютеру. USB порты могут использоваться для передачи данных, а также для подачи питания на устройство.
  • Bluetooth: этот тип последовательного порта используется для беспроводной передачи данных между устройствами. Bluetooth порты могут быть использованы для подключения различных устройств, таких как наушники, клавиатуры и мобильные телефоны.

Выбор конкретного типа последовательного порта зависит от нужд пользователей и требований к периферийным устройствам, которые будут подключаться.

Применение последовательных портов

Последовательные порты находят широкое применение в различных устройствах и системах, где необходимо передавать данные в последовательном порядке. Ниже приведены некоторые примеры использования последовательных портов:

  • Компьютерные системы: В компьютерных системах последовательные порты используются для подключения периферийных устройств, таких как мыши, клавиатуры, принтеры, сканеры, модемы и т.д. Последовательные порты позволяют передавать данные между компьютером и подключенными устройствами в последовательном формате.
  • Программирование микроконтроллеров: Микроконтроллеры часто имеют встроенные последовательные порты, которые позволяют программистам взаимодействовать с микроконтроллером и передавать ему команды и данные. Это позволяет создавать различные электронные устройства, такие как роботы, автоматические системы и т.д.
  • Промышленные системы: В промышленных системах последовательные порты широко используются для передачи данных между различными устройствами и системами. Например, в контроллерах автоматического управления, системах мониторинга или системах сбора данных.
  • Сетевые устройства: Некоторые сетевые устройства, такие как маршрутизаторы или коммутаторы, имеют последовательные порты, которые используются для настройки и управления устройством через специальные консольные кабели.
  • Решения IoT: В сфере интернета вещей (IoT) последовательные порты могут использоваться для связи с различными устройствами IoT, такими как датчики, контроллеры или промышленные IoT-устройства.

Это лишь некоторые примеры использования последовательных портов. Благодаря своей простоте и универсальности, последовательные порты остаются популярным средством передачи данных во многих областях. При выборе последовательного порта для конкретного применения следует учитывать требования к скорости передачи данных, формату данных и типу подключаемых устройств.

Оцените статью